S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: On June 15, 1984, OMB delegated to the Board
authority under the Paperwork Reduction Act (PRA) to approve and assign
OMB control numbers to collections of information conducted or
sponsored by the Board. In exercising this delegated authority, the
Board is directed to take every reasonable step to solicit comment. In
determining whether to approve a collection of information, the Board
will consider all comments received from the public and other agencies.

Proposal Under OMB Delegated Authority To Extend for Three Years, With
Revision, the Following Information Collection
Collection title: Consolidated Report of Condition and Income for
Edge and Agreement Corporations.
Collection identifier: FR 2886b.
OMB control number: 7100-0086.
General description of collection: The FR 2886b reporting form is
filed quarterly or annually by Edge and agreement corporations
(collectively, Edges or Edge corporations). The Board is responsible
for authorizing, supervising, and assigning ratings to Edges. The Board
and the Federal Reserve Banks use the data collected by the FR 2886b to
supervise Edge corporations and to monitor and develop a better
understanding of Edge activities.
Proposed revisions: The Board proposes to revise the FR 2886b form
and instructions to be consistent with adopted changes to U.S.
gener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P) related to troubled
debt restructurings, provisions for credit losses on off-balance sheet
credit exposures, and expected recoveries of amounts previously charged
off included within the allowances for credit losses. The Board also
proposes to revise the FR 2886b instructions by (1) specifying when
respondents should submit their reports if the submission deadline
falls on a weekend or holiday, and (2) adding a recordkeeping
requirement for respondents to maintain a record of the data submitted
for three years. These revisions are proposed to take effect as of the
December 31, 2024, as-of date.
Frequency: Quarterly and annually.
Respondents: Edge and agreement corporations.
Total estimated number of respondents: 64.
Total estimated change in burden: 96.
Total estimated annual burden hours: 1,432.
